  • Engine 06/04/2026

    While driving, my vehicle experienced a sudden engine malfunction consistent with a failed head gasket. The engine began misfiring, shaking, and losing power, and the check engine light began flashing. The vehicle became unsafe to operate. The failed component is the engine head gasket, and the vehicle is available for inspection upon request. The sudden loss of engine performance created a serious safety concern. I was driving on a public roadway when the engine began misfiring and losing power, making it difficult to safely maintain speed and operate the vehicle. A sudden loss of power while driving increases the risk of being rear-ended or becoming involved in a collision, particularly in traffic, while merging, or at highway speeds. The vehicle was inspected and diagnosed by an authorized Honda dealership, which confirmed the head gasket failure.
